Today is World Diabetes Day and to be honest I'm flat. The fire emergency here in Australia combined with higher blood sugars have kept me from my usual enthusiasm. But it's not just that. It's hard to put a positive spin on diabetes all the time. All I can say is my daily yoga practice pulls me out of the doom and gloom. It reminds me that as much as I like to get lost in the details around my health management it's never going to be perfect. Control is necessary but there has to be some wiggle room. Giving myself a hard time isn't productive. I've learned to relax in the tougher poses, to breathe deep and find stillness. These mini lessons are perfect metaphors for the ups and downs of this disease. And believe me I need that right now.
